Rope is another great quality update for early game (before you can jump 30 feet and fly.) You can place it or throw a coil of it at a ledge and climb up. It just takes care of a lot of the frustration from pre-grappling hook gameplay. And now you can also make grappling hooks out of gemstones, and gems seem a lot more common. So I didn't even have to farm skeletons and piranha, just deal with a purple hook until I got an Ivy Whip sorted out.

Edit:
Or after you've built a hellevator but before finding a magic mirror. You can go up it nearly (or equally) as fast as falling, and fall by it without it slowing you down. Also pressing up grabs on and can save your life if you are bad a double jump. You just need a ton, but you can find it in pots and merchant has it cheap.

Oh, and many things stack to 999 now. THANK GOD.
